HPC环境配置实践指南 高性能计算(HPC)环境配置是现代科学研究和工程领域必不可少的一部分。在当今信息时代,数据量正在以前所未有的速度增长,因此对于大规模数据处理和复杂计算任务的需求也在不断增加。 为了充分发挥HPC系统的性能,必须对其环境进行合理配置。这就需要对硬件、软件、网络和其他相关组件进行正确的设置和调整,以实现系统的最佳性能。 首先,对于HPC系统的硬件配置,需要根据预期的计算任务和数据处理需求来选择合适的处理器、内存、存储和互连网络等硬件组件。一般来说,对于计算密集型任务,需要选择高性能的多核处理器,大内存容量和快速的存储设备。 其次,对于HPC系统的软件配置,需要选择适合的操作系统、并行计算库、编译器和其他工具。操作系统的选择对于系统的稳定性和性能至关重要,而并行计算库和编译器则可以影响到程序的并行性能和可扩展性。 此外,HPC系统的网络配置也是至关重要的一环。高性能的互连网络可以有效地减少节点之间的通信延迟,从而提高整个系统的计算效率。 在进行HPC环境配置时,还需要考虑系统的安全性和可管理性。采取合适的安全措施和管理策略可以保护系统免受恶意攻击和意外故障的影响,同时也可以提高系统的可维护性和可管理性。 总而言之,HPC环境配置是一个复杂而细致的工作,需要综合考虑硬件、软件、网络、安全和管理等多个方面的因素。只有在全面考虑了这些因素之后,才能够实现HPC系统的最佳性能,并为科学研究和工程应用提供强大的计算支持。希望本文的HPC环境配置实践指南能够帮助读者更好地理解和应用HPC技术,从而更好地应对日益增长的计算需求。 |
说点什么...